Relation to Minecraft

When speaking of online building games, one cannot overlook the colossal influence of Minecraft. Launched in 2011, Minecraft's innovative design reshaped the gaming world, positioning building mechanics at the forefront. Its success lies in the simplicity of its block-based system, allowing players to create virtually anything, limited only by their imaginations.

The correlation between other online building games and Minecraft often manifests in various dimensions:

  • Graphics Style: Many games utilize a pixelated or blocky aesthetic, directly inspired by Minecraft’s visual narrative.
  • Gameplay Mechanics: Concepts such as resource gathering, crafting, and construction find their roots in Minecraft’s framework.
  • Community Engagement: Just like Minecraft, many online building games thrive on community involvement, with players sharing experiences and creations.

Thus, understanding the relationship between these games and Minecraft provides deeper insight into their design philosophy and development trajectory. Each game draws from Minecraft’s legacy, echoing its charm while contributing to a vibrant ecosystem of digital creativity.

Roblox: A Platform for Infinite Creativity

Roblox can be best described as a creative playground. It invites players to not only engage in gameplay but also to build their creations from the ground up. Unlike many other platforms, Roblox offers an extensive suite of development tools that enable users to design their games with relative ease.

  • User-generated Content: Players can contribute their designs and scripts, fostering a sense of ownership and empowerment.
  • Game Variety: The variety of games available is impressive, from obstacle courses to RPGs, which keeps the gameplay fresh.

This unique setup allows developers to experiment with different game mechanics and narrative styles, enhancing their programming and design skills. The fact of the matter is, with thousands of new games released every day, it is a great environment to learn and practice.

Terraria: A Sandbox Adventure

Terraria is often appreciated for its depth of gameplay. Unlike Minecraft's blocky 3D world, it offers a 2D sandbox experience that combines construction, exploration, and combat. Players dig, build, and fight in a procedurally generated world, which presents both opportunities and challenges.

  • Diverse Environments: Players can explore a variety of biomes, each offering unique resources and enemies. This encourages creativity in building structures tailored to each environment.
  • Crafting System: The crafting system is extensive, allowing for the creation of weapons, armor, and tools that can change the way players engage with the environment.

The blend of exploration and combat adds a layer of excitement, making it easy to lose track of time while you dig underground or build a castle in the sky.

Blockland: A Unique Building Experience

Blockland stands out in the building game landscape due to its Truelogic engine that empowers players to construct intricate virtual environments. Unlike more traditional building games, Blockland leans heavily on creativity and the social aspect of gaming.

  • No Defined Objectives: The freedom to create without predefined goals means that each player's journey can look completely different.
  • Great Community: A vibrant community shares mods and models, contributing to an ever-evolving experience that players can access.

This freedom leads to innovative creations that showcase players' skills and imagination, making it a unique hub for enthusiasts.

Eco: Fostering Environmental Awareness

Eco takes a different approach by integrating environmental science into the building game model. Players are tasked with constructing a civilization in a simulated ecosystem, emphasizing sustainability and community decision-making.

  • Real World Implications: What sets Eco apart is its focus on the ecological impact of players' choices. Every action has consequences, offering a rich learning experience.
  • Collaborative Development: Players must work together to balance development with environmental conservation.

This social experiment promotes teamwork and critical thinking, making it an engaging example of how games can educate while providing entertainment.
